30 W. Oak St., No. 7A, Chicago: $2,450,000 | Listed: Aug. 20, 2021
This three-bedroom home has three full bathrooms, one half-bath and more than 60 feet of floor-to-ceiling windows. The kitchen has white lacquered Poggenpohl upper cabinetry, a cantilevered island and a butler’s pantry. Double glass sliding doors from the kitchen and dining rooms lead to a terrace that offers city views and a glimpse of the lake. The primary bedroom features Arabesque wallcovering, a floor-to-ceiling headboard with a built-in hardwood bed, floating lacquered nightstands, automatic custom shades and a crystal pendant light with a shade. This home has marble floors throughout except in the bedrooms, where the floors are wood. An Eco Smart fire feature, a Murano glass light installation in the dining room and a garage parking space complete this home.
